To those receiveing the Opcache Operator error with xCache:
Quote:
If you don't know what your PHP handler is but you have ssh access, you can run this command if you have cPanel (or just ask your host): Code:
/usr/local/cpanel/bin/rebuild_phpconf --current Code:
Available handlers: suphp dso cgi none Code:
Available handlers: suphp dso cgi none PHP optcode caching doesn't work 100% with SuPHP because SuPHP doesn't use a shared user when processing PHP files. I'd definitely talk to your webhost before making any changes or get an individual opinion on your particular configuration. FastCGI on the limited resources (like limited cloud hosting) many forum owners are hosted on will usually outperform even DSO with an accelerator. |

Since installing this, I'm asked to give my xcache login details when editing a users usergroup. How can I stop this from happening?
|
MikeWarner - You either need to disable XCache authentification in php.ini, or enable XCache Authentification within the vB Optimise options and edit /vboptimise/config.php and enter your XCache username/password (in plain text) so vBO can automatically log in for you.
